Hi release team — an update on Quillpipe, our message queue. The new log compaction pass now runs incrementally rather than in stop-the-world windows, which eliminates the consumer stalls we saw during the Ferrow incident. Compaction lag is surfaced as a first-class metric, and the retention policy defaults were tightened after review with the storage group. Please verify the dashboard thresholds before sign-off, and do not promote until the canary soak completes its 24-hour window. The trace for the soak run follows.

trace token, fafog-kageg: htk4_98e6

## Releases

Bulk-edit support for the Ledgerpane admin table ships on a two-week cadence. Each release candidate is cut from `main`, tagged, and run through the batch-mutation regression suite, which replays recorded multi-row edits against a snapshot database. Reviewers should confirm that migration scripts touching the `bulk_ops` queue are reversible and that the audit log captures every row affected by a bulk action. Release artifacts are signed before upload to the internal registry. Verify packages against the release signing key below.

release key, kahif-yagap: bky3_1JN

/*
 * Snapshot client for the Lintglass UI suite.
 * Captures rendered component trees and diffs them against
 * golden files stored in the Snapbank service. Do not bump
 * the renderer version without regenerating all baselines,
 * or every diff will fail noisily. Snapbank requires
 * authenticated access for baseline writes; the client reads
 * its key from the line below.
 */

API key for fahip-kahip: zpat23_XiJGUHz5xfaAtaIqUkus0rh